Transaction 8673a1b2384050370612a8f77329a355d7fa0831443436103caec1d2e930574e
1 Input
1 Output
-
8673a1b2384050370612a8f77329a355d7fa0831443436103caec1d2e930574e:0
- value
- 177832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fecd36ca235b32f6ac8fada14efd500618b5136a OP_EQUAL
- address
- 3QvHPni5TYzY6ngRaoeBZha7E4KyyHsRAo